Tree installation services involve the careful planting of new trees on residential, commercial, or public properties. These services typically include selecting appropriate tree species, preparing the planting site, and properly positioning the tree to ensure healthy growth. Professionals may also perform soil preparation, root assessment, and initial stabilization to help the tree establish itself effectively. The goal is to ensure that the tree is installed securely and has the optimal conditions to thrive over time.
This service helps address common problems associated with improper planting, such as poor tree health, instability, or damage to surrounding structures. Incorrectly installed trees can pose safety risks, be prone to disease, or fail to grow as intended. Tree installation specialists aim to mitigate these issues by following best practices for planting depth, soil conditioning, and site assessment, which can contribute to the long-term vitality and safety of the landscape.

Material Costs - The cost of tree installation materials typically ranges from $150 to $600 per tree, depending on species and size. Larger or specialty trees can increase the overall expense.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ific tree selections.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for tree installation generally fall between $300 and $1,000 per project. Factors influencing price include site accessibility and tree size. Contractors may charge additional fees for complex or large-scale installations.
Site Preparation - Preparing the planting site can add $100 to $400 to the total cost, covering soil preparation, root excavation, and other groundwork. Proper preparation ensures healthy growth and can vary by site conditions.
Additional Services - Extra services such as staking, mulching, or soil amendments may range from $50 to $200 each. These enhancements can support tree health and stability but are typically optional and priced separately.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
